Transaction 37d58de1fc6a814e7642f569c589dbf16da214b7d9f5fc48ef8aa64ca5b94772
1 Input
1 Output
-
37d58de1fc6a814e7642f569c589dbf16da214b7d9f5fc48ef8aa64ca5b94772:0
- value
- 558043
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f68681a78745409c91eae2027dd863f1e738e91 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18EsTTTJFB1pWCf4RGkUuqHj8fmDr4qHKF